Output 338338253d6233eae84401f355696f332b4893fee39efa4d15aa639c90df4429:1

value
12058205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e8fb11443547141cf3a9e06f8a78061d793aedf OP_EQUAL
address
3G9QpjCWvjBzfHnv9o3mzZmg4gYCyhuQEA
transaction
338338253d6233eae84401f355696f332b4893fee39efa4d15aa639c90df4429
spent
true